首先,需要将“开发工具”激活以使用VBA。在Excel选项的“自定义功能区”中,勾选“开发工具”。 在工具栏中会多出开发工具标签 点击Visual Basic,打开VBA界面。右击VBAProject,选择“插入” – “类模块” 选择该模块,在下方的属性中将名称修改为C_CellColorChange 双击该模块,粘贴以下代码: OptionExplicitPrivateWithE...
currCell.Interior.color = RGB(r, g, b) If GetContrastColor(currCell.Interior.color) = vbBlack Then currCell.Font.color = vbBlack Else currCell.Font.color = vbWhite End If currCell.Offset(0, -1).Interior.color = RGB(r, g, b) End With Q = Q + 1 End Sub Sub AutoChangeColor(...
VBA Code To Color The ActiveSheet If you need to change the color of the tab you are currently viewing, you can use the following VBA macro code along with your desired RGB color code: Sub ChangeTabColor() 'Objective: Change Selected Tab To Specific Color ActiveSheet.Tab.Color = RGB(25,...
VBA 方法/步骤 1 找到目标文件 2 鼠标右键,选择打开方式为excel 3 打开文件后,在菜单栏中找到“开发工具”下的Visual Basic 4 双击需要进行设置的目标sheet表,如图所示 5 在程序编辑框中编辑代码如下:Private Sub Worksheet_Change(ByVal Target As Range)Target.Interior.Color = vbRedEnd Sub 6 关闭程序框...
excel vba 单元格内部关键字突出显示改变颜色 alt+f11 在工作簿中添加代码如下,运行子过程,随便输入个名字比如A,然后关掉即可 如何运行:选中一个区域自动就会运行,Worksheet_SelectionChange这个函数名字是特殊关键词,是一个选中区域改变的回调函数,跟下图的触发方式有关...
在模块1中,我们定义了几个公共变量,包括颜色生成的逻辑、颜色应用及记录的实现。在ChangeColor过程中,我们使用Rnd函数生成随机数,并将其转换为0~255的RGB颜色值。此过程通过设置单元格背景色实现,并将颜色值记录至I列。AutoChangeColor过程实现了自动换色逻辑,我们在此基础上增加了判断条件,确保在...
假设我们有一个64*64的correlation matrix,那么在excel中是用vba对不同范围的correlation值的单元格添加背景颜色的代码如下: 1SubchangeBgColor()2DimiAsInteger3DimjAsInteger4DimrAsInteger5DimcAsInteger678r =67'最后一行是第67行9c =66'最后一列是第66列1011Fori =3Tor'迭代,从第3行开始,一直到最后一行12Fo...
1 VBA程序知识拓展延伸1、Excel表格菜单栏上面没有【开发工具】选项时,可以使用【Alt+F11】组合键调出VBE编辑器。2、“Application.EnableEvents = False”主要是关闭触发联锁事件,避免其重复执行,影响软件的正常运行。3、颜色值常数(如:vbGreen)种类有限,如果要使用到其他的颜色,可以使用RGB代替(如:Target....
1 打开Excel工作表之后,按下【Alt+F11】组合键打开VBA编辑器。2 在VBA编辑器的菜单栏里边点击【插入】、【模块】。3 在模块的代码框里边输入以下程序代码:Sub ColorChange()Dim i, j, k, x, rn, arr1On Error Resume Next '忽略运行过程中可能出现的错误Set mysheet1 = ThisWorkbook.Worksheets("...
看着简单,但作者研究了半天,却只能想到用VBA来做。 下面就是制作步骤: STEP1:制作图表源 在A1单元格输入“数据源”,在A2:A101单元格区域输入100个1,作为图表的占位数据; STEP2:选中A1:A101单元格区域,工具栏插入——图表——环形图,得到下面的图表。